RFP Description

The vendor required to provide website and trumpet design and configuration services for includes updating our website to be visible to ai functions, guaranteeing that the department will remain visible to relevant audiences as the internet changes with the evolution of ai-assisted searches.
- Main website (external site)
1. Design and visuals
•    Shall install and configure new WordPress or another platform website
•    Shall include base theme styling for site
•    Shall design home page
•    Shall include department branding on all pages
•    Shall assist in developing a page structure that improves useability and functionality
•    Shall include template(s) for future content entry
•    Shall produce mobile design and compatibility
•    Should ensure web design is intuitive and easy to navigate
•    On the "find offices" page, should include an interactive map of state, with clickable counties that take the user to the office page.
•    Should integrate a "contact us" messaging system on each office page.
•    Shall redesign header menus and footer to improve clarity and design
•    Should integrate social media into the site (as appropriate) beyond just the footer
•    Should include breadcrumbs or navigation aids for users on deeper pages
•    Shall ensure consistent branding, typography, colors, and spacing is used throughout
2. Technical and performance
•    Shall optimize site for various devices (phone, tablet, laptop and desktop)
•    Shall include SEO audit to evaluate website performance and make improvements to boost visibility in search engine
•    Should include menu structure audit to ensure easy navigability
•    Should improve internal linking as needed
•    Shall ensure website adheres to new ADA requirements to accommodate users with disabilities (text alternatives for non-text content, sufficient color contrast, etc.)
•    Should include options for larger text size or to toggle accessibility features, including required tagging of photographs and other visuals.
•    Language translation options should be made available
•    Should ensure pdfs and downloadable files are accessible (i.e., tagged for screen readers)
•    Should include improved search function
•    Shall include a documented backup and restore strategy, including automated scheduled backups and procedures for restoring all site data and configurations.
•    Shall provide a disaster recovery (DR) and failover plan, including geographic redundancy and defined recovery time objective (RTO) and recovery point objective (RPO) parameters.
•    Should establish ongoing support and maintenance requirements, including clearly defined service level agreements (SLAs) for uptime, issue response, and resolution times.
3. Content
•    Should provide recommendations on improving jargon and call-to-actions
•    Should include more photos throughout website (we can provide photos as directed)
•    Should include improved contact forms with confirmation messages
•    Should include incorporation of database (or other system) to allow for easy changing of photos and associated blurbs
4. Miscellaneous
•    Shall create and provide a content update guide for staff
•    Should set up and configure google analytics (e.g., for most visited pages, search terms, internal search terms, user behavior, etc.)
•    Should provide general recommendations on improvement
- Trumpet (internal site)
1. Design
•    Shall install and configure new WordPress (or another platform) website as a subsite of the external department website
•    Shall include base theme styling for site
•    Shall design login landing page
•    Shall design home page
•    Should include department branding on all pages
•    Shall include homepage with direct access to different categories on the site (categories will be determined beforehand); this can include a directory, menu, and sidebar
•    Should assist in developing a page structure that improves useability and functionality
•    Should include template(s) for future content entry
•    Shall include mobile design and compatibility
•    Shall take primary role in building out and designing the new motion bank and learning materials database
2. Data migration
•    Shall transfer all existing content from state current trumpet site to new site
•    Should ensure page hierarchies will be preserved
•    Should ensure current links to existing content will continue to work as expected
3. User accounts
•    Shall include initial setup of user accounts (we will provide an up-to-date list of logins needed)
•    Should provide roster management for owners and admins, including creation of new accounts, password resets, edits to user accounts, ability to delete or inactivate user accounts)
•    Should provide user profile management
•    Shall integrate with established department user accounts, leveraging existing active directory (ad) identities for authentication.
•    Should support single sign-on (SSO) using the organization’s active directory infrastructure.
•    Should enforce multi-factor authentication (MFA) in alignment with current security policies and standards.
•    Should provide role-based access controls (RBAC) to ensure users only have access to appropriate areas of the intranet (owners, admins, and others to be determined).
